Explore the detailed anatomy of ants, from their exoskeletons and compound eyes to their fast-moving mandibles. This video highlights how ants use their six legs, antennae, and other body parts to sense, survive, and interact within their complex colonies. Find out how ants are equipped with unique adaptations that make them efficient predators and survivors in diverse environments.
